Octavia Spencer told Jessica Chastain about women of color’s salaries, and here’s what she did
Jessica Chastain is here to prove to you that Time’s Up is more than just a pin and a website. When her Academy Award-winning costar Octavia Spencer wanted to discuss the gender wage gap in Hollywood and how severely it affects women of color, Chastain was shocked and spurred to action.
“She said, ‘You and I are gonna be tied together,'” Spencer said at a Sundance Panel. “‘We’re gonna be favored nations, and we’re gonna make the same thing, you are going to make that amount.’ Fast-forward to last week, we’re making five times what we asked for.”

In a surreal – yet too real – moment on Saturday Night Live tonight, Jessica Chastain deliberately broke character as a talk show host to lament, what even matters anymore?
Chastain ostensibly plays host Veronica Elders, quizzing contestants played by Cecily Strong, Kate McKinnon, and Kenan Thompson on whether newsworthy things President Trump has said or done recently even rate among his base or the media today.
Not surprisingly, nothing does.
Even hypothetical situations, however objectively horrible, don’t matter.
“The president fires Robert Mueller, the very man investigating him for treason. Does it even matter?” host Veronica asks. Read more…

Jessica Chastain, lamenting both her dearth of fun, flighty girl roles and her absence from this weekend’s Women’s Marches, gave a singing, dancing monologue to kick off tonight’s Saturday Night Live hosting duties – all to the tune of Lesley Gore’s female empowerment anthem, “You Don’t Own Me.”
Flanked by SNL mainstays Kate McKinnon and Cecily Strong, Chastain belted out the classic, while Aidy Bryant celebrated with pink “P-Hats.”
“I can’t say the real word ‘cos it’s just one of those many words that only the president can use,” Bryant clarified.
“You mean ‘Pussy Hat?'” Thank goodness for Leslie Jones. Read more…

The Los Angeles Times‘ magazine Envelope got into a bit of trouble with the internet and film fans last week.
Actresses Jessica Chastain, Annette Bening, Margot Robbie, Diane Kruger, Saoirse Ronan, and Kate Winslet donned the cover of the issue, which was exploring ‘a shift in focus’ on how stories are being told in film—but the image and subsequent conversation included no women of color.
The publication was called out for its lack of inclusion, and the ever outspoken Chastain responded to disheartened readers with a question and her own thoughts on the problem.

Hollywood audition culture is notoriously sexist — celebrities like Jennifer Lawrence and Emmy Rossum have spoken out about it before. And in a new sketch from Friday’s Tonight Show, Jessica Chastain took another dig at the famously toxic process.
In the sketch, Chastain shows up at an audition to read for “Angela.” The part seems straightforward enough, until the casting director (played by Jimmy Fallon) starts asking her to “do it again, but hot” and, in a truly cringeworthy moment, to read her lines like a “spicy little peppermint with a secret.” (Of course, when a male actor comes in to audition, he receives no notes.)
